引言
Visual FoxPro(VFP)是一种功能强大的数据库管理系统,它允许用户创建、编辑和管理数据库。数据表是VFP中的核心概念,是存储数据的主要结构。本文将深入探讨VFP数据表的管理与处理技巧,帮助用户轻松掌握数据奥秘。
VFP数据表的基本概念
1. 数据表的定义
数据表是VFP中用来存储数据的结构,它由行和列组成,类似于电子表格。每一行代表一条记录,每一列代表一个字段。
2. 数据表的类型
- 自由表:独立于数据库存在的表,可以单独打开和操作。
- 数据库表:属于某个数据库的表,需要通过数据库管理。
创建和管理VFP数据表
1. 创建数据表
CREATE TABLE mytable (
id INT,
name VARCHAR(50),
age INT
)
2. 修改数据表结构
ALTER TABLE mytable ADD COLUMN email VARCHAR(100)
3. 删除数据表
DROP TABLE mytable
VFP数据表操作
1. 插入记录
INSERT INTO mytable (id, name, age) VALUES (1, 'Alice', 25)
2. 更新记录
UPDATE mytable SET age = 26 WHERE id = 1
3. 删除记录
DELETE FROM mytable WHERE id = 1
4. 查询记录
SELECT * FROM mytable WHERE age > 20
VFP数据表的高级操作
1. 索引
索引可以加快数据表的查询速度。在VFP中创建索引的语法如下:
CREATE INDEX idx_age ON mytable (age)
2. 视图
视图是一个虚拟表,它可以从多个表或视图中提取数据。创建视图的语法如下:
CREATE VIEW myview AS SELECT id, name FROM mytable
3. 存储过程
存储过程是一组为了完成特定任务的SQL语句集合。在VFP中创建存储过程的语法如下:
CREATE PROCEDURE myprocedure AS
SELECT * FROM mytable
ENDPROC
总结
VFP数据表是数据库管理的基础,掌握数据表的管理与处理技巧对于高效处理数据至关重要。通过本文的介绍,用户应该能够轻松管理VFP数据表,并利用其强大的功能进行高效数据处理。
